Discover the timeless wisdom of Ethics of Aristotle, one of the most influential works in the history of philosophy and moral thought. In this enduring classic, Aristotle explores the principles of Ethics, Virtue, Happiness, Character Development, Moral Philosophy, and the pursuit of a meaningful life. Rather than offering simple rules, this remarkable work encourages readers to cultivate wisdom, self-discipline, and balanced judgment, making it an essential read for anyone seeking personal growth, intellectual enrichment, and a deeper understanding of human nature.

Through thoughtful analysis and practical reasoning, Aristotle explains that true happiness is achieved not through wealth or pleasure alone, but through the consistent practice of virtue and the development of excellent character. His profound discussions on courage, justice, friendship, generosity, temperance, and practical wisdom reveal how everyday choices shape both individual lives and society. These timeless teachings continue to influence philosophy, psychology, leadership, education, and ethics, remaining as relevant today as they were over two thousand years ago.
